Marketing Peer Group

The Marketing peer group is a growing community of around 140 marketing and communication professionals who meet, learn and exchange marketing knowledge and experiences with like-minded peers. General job titles who attend this group include Heads of Marketing, Marketing Directors and Marketing Managers.

Events

We meet three to four times a year, with a mix of online and face-to-face sessions hosted at members' organisations. We focus on both strategic and tactical themes to support marketers. Sometimes a member of the group will present a topic and other times, we’ll arrange for a specialist facilitator to join to present a topical theme that’s pertinent to marketing.

Recent topics include: data-led PR campaigns, value propositions, Google Analytics 4 and storytelling.

Who can join?

Attendees are generally middle/senior marketing professionals from some of the larger Cambridge Network member companies, comprising of a wide range of backgrounds, expertise and marketing challenges.

The Marketing peer group is free to attend for Cambridge Network members working in the relevant job functions.

Please note, peer groups are available to organisations with six or more staff.
